If you have eye arc, try these treatment options: Take a pain … WebLocal anaesthetic ( benoxinate or proxymetacaine) should only be used if required to aid examination, and not for pain relief Drops: tear supplements (preferably unpreserved) for symptomatic relief Ointment: unmedicated (to ease discomfort through lubrication) Oral analgesic for pain relief (e.g. ibuprofen, paracetamol)

If your eyes aren’t getting any better or are getting worse, it’s … WebUV radiation in a welding arc will burn unprotected skin just like UV radiation in sunlight. This hazard is true for direct exposure to UV radiation as well as radiation that is reflected from metal surfaces, walls, and ceilings. Flash Burns. Welding can expose your eyes to flash burns from the welding arc. A flash burn occurs when your eyes are exposed to bright ultraviolet (UV) light. The intense UV light sunburns the surface of the eye, which can be very painful. How to Respond: Remove yourself from the area and call for help.

WebSunscreens containing zinc oxide are acknowledged as the best for preventing welding burns. Choose a sunscreen with a minimum of SPF 30, but SPF 45 or 50 is better for welding protection. Pick a 'broad spectrum' sunscreen since they offer protection from almost any rays emitted during welding.
